1. Quick Diagnostic Table

If you see… (Symptom) It likely means… (Root Cause) Priority Level
Rejected, Turned Down, Denied Failed credit or fraud risk assessment (AI model or financier rule mismatch) High
Pending Review or Delayed Missing or inconsistent data; manual check required Medium
Application Not Forwarded Incomplete document upload or system validation error Medium
Duplicate Submission Warning Resubmission of existing/identical application Low

3. Step-by-Step Resolution (Fix Actions)

Phase 1: Immediate Verification

Step 1: Check borrower and vehicle data completeness. Ensure all fields (income, employment, vehicle details) are filled and match uploaded documents. Use Multi-Modal Data Input to extract and verify data automatically.

Step 2: Validate applicant identity via Singpass Integration. For Singapore, ensure Singpass/Myinfo consent is granted, and identity documents are clear and current. Mismatched or expired IDs are a top cause of delay.

Step 3: Use the Finance Calculator to confirm the requested loan amount and tenure align with the financier’s Loan-to-Value (LTV) and TDSR policies.

Step 4: Review the Fraud Detection results. If flagged, check for document tampering, duplicate applications, or blacklisted applicants.

Q: Why was my application delayed even after following all required steps?

A: Delays can occur due to financier-side manual review, regulatory checks (e.g. TDSR, AML), or pending Myinfo consent. For more, see the Auto Finance Risk Management Comprehensive Guide 2026.

Q: What does a “Fraud Detection” flag mean in my application status?

A: This indicates that the AI engine has found possible anomalies, such as altered documents or blacklisted identity. Review all uploads for clarity and authenticity before resubmission. See Fraud Detection for detailed guidance.
